E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
缓冲池
android中的享元模式,Android源码看设计模式(十)--------关于享元模式的Handler相关分析...
享元模式定义:使用共享对象能够有效的支持大量的细粒度的对象html应用场景系统中存在大量的类似对象细粒度的对象都具有比较接近的外部状态,而内部状态与环境无关,也就是说对象没有特定身份须要
缓冲池
的场景享元模式的写法
missapen
·
2022-11-13 09:35
android中的享元模式
android中的享元模式,Android 享元模式
多用于存在大量重复对象的场景,或需要
缓冲池
的时候。用来缓存共享的对象。这样来避免内存移除等。二、定义运用共享技术有效的支持大量细粒度的对象。
Zhen Chen
·
2022-11-13 09:05
android中的享元模式
Android设计模式-21-享元模式
1.定义运用共享技术有效的支持大量细粒度的对象2.使用场景系统中存在大量的相似对象细粒度的对象都具备较接近的外部状态,而内部状态与环境无关,也就是说对象没有特定身份需要
缓冲池
的场景3.优缺点优点:大幅度降低内存中对象的数量
今阳
·
2022-11-13 09:58
Android设计模式
设计模式
java
android
编程语言
Android设计模式-享元模式
多用于存在大量重复对象的场景,或需要
缓冲池
的时候。享元模式是对象池技术的重要实现方式,池里都是创建好的对象,无需再创建可直接拿来使用,这样减少了重复对象的创建,从而降低内存、提升性能。
孟芳芳
·
2022-11-13 08:41
android
MySQL查询缓存和
缓冲池
的区别
一
缓冲池
在InnoDB存储引擎中,一部分数据会被放到内存中,
缓冲池
则占了这部分内存的大部分,它用来存储各种数据的缓存,包括:数据页,插入缓存,自适应索引哈希,索引页,锁信息,数据字典信息等。
qq_41699660
·
2022-11-08 11:35
MySQL
缓冲池
查询缓存
JDBC 数据库连接池
数据库连接池的基本思想:就是为数据库连接建立一个“
缓冲池
”。预先在
缓冲池
中放入一定数量的连接,当需要建立数据库连接时,只需从“
缓冲池
”中取出一个,使用完毕之后再放回去。
Try_ToBetter
·
2022-11-02 14:15
Database
数据库
mysql
database
InnoDB事务剖析
InnoDB事务剖析1.事务简介2.InnoDB基础简介页记录
缓冲池
缓存参数3.InnoDB关键特性3.1插入缓冲(InsertBuffer)数据插入原理InsertBuffer的优点InsertBuffer
大摩羯先生
·
2022-11-02 08:01
mysql
学习总结
mysql
innodb
数据库事务
acid
mysql体系结构及四种部署方式
目录mysql体系结构MySQL安装部署mysql体系结构一、连接层思想为解决资源的频繁分配-释放所造成的问题,为数据库连接建立一个“
缓冲池
”。
蒋猪猪
·
2022-10-21 22:46
sql
shell
mysql
数据库
服务器
MySQL高级:(一)MySQL逻辑架构
文章目录1.1逻辑架构剖析小结1.2SQL执行流程小结1.3SQL语法顺序1.4数据库
缓冲池
1.4.1
缓冲池
的概念1.4.2缓存池的重要性1.4.3缓存原则1.4.4缓存池的预读特性1.4.5
缓冲池
读取数据的流程
叁弟
·
2022-10-17 20:40
数据库
mysql
架构
数据库
字节跳动后端面经七
InnoDb针对数据库
缓冲池
管理使用LRU算法,做了哪些优化联合索引相关场景,给了个sql,问能不能用上索引线程的状态线程池可以配哪些参数线程池核心线程数是什么如果让你设计一个线程池,该怎么设计Java
·
2022-10-16 21:13
后端
MySQL架构原理4 InnoDB存储引擎结构(了解)
BufferPool:
缓冲池
,简称BP。BP以Page页为单位,默认大小16K,BP的底层采用链表数据结构管理Page。在InnoDB访问表记录和索引时会在P
大唐雨夜
·
2022-10-15 01:45
mysql
架构
链表
MySQL的逻辑架构
本人也在学习阶段,如若发现问题,请告知,非常感谢逻辑架构逻辑架构剖析Connectors第一层:连接层第二层:服务层第三层:引擎层存储层SQL执行流程MySQL的SQL执行流程MySQL中的执行原理数据库
缓冲池
我叫意志李
·
2022-10-01 08:37
数据库
mysql
架构
服务器
【mysql】-- Mysql-InnoDB的内存和磁盘架构详解
这里写自定义目录标题一、mysql的逻辑架构1、连接器2、查询缓存3、分析器4、优化器5、执行器二、innoDB的内存和磁盘结构三、bufferpool
缓冲池
1、bufferpool介绍2、SQL的读写操作原理
DreamBoy_W.W.Y
·
2022-09-30 07:40
mysql
mysql
MySQL技术内幕:MySQL—InnoDB存储引擎体系架构——详解
2.1InnoDB架构图2.2后台线程2.2.1MasterThread2.2.2IOThread2.2.3PurgeThread2.2.4PageCleanerThread2.3内存2.3.1内存池组成2.3.2
缓冲池
我是方小磊
·
2022-09-30 07:31
Mysql技术内幕
数据库
mysql
innodb
体系架构
存储引擎
数据库篇之InnoDB存储引擎
文章目录1.数据库和实例2.MySQL数据库3.存储引擎介绍3.1InnoDB3.2MyISAM4.连接数据库5.InnoDB存储引擎5.1后台线程5.2内存1)
缓冲池
读页操作写页操作缓冲的数据类型管理页脏页
witheredwood
·
2022-09-29 18:49
数据库
数据库
InnoDB
频繁使用MySQL,磁盘IO高峰或爆满,innodb_buffer_pool_size解决方案
在优化这个定时任务前,了解到MySQL中的innodb_buffer_pool_size参数,这个参数用来设置Innodb
缓冲池
大小且默认
Uhiroshi
·
2022-09-25 10:30
一条sql详解MYSQL的架构设计详情
目录1前言2应用层2.1连接线程处理3服务层3.1SQL接口3.2SQL解析器3.3SQL优化器3.4执行器3.5查询缓存4存储引擎层4.1概述4.2
缓冲池
(bufferpool)4.2.1数据页、缓存页和脏页
·
2022-09-24 07:58
MySQL高级——锁
例如,操作
缓冲池
中的LRU列表,删除、添加、移动LRU列表中的元素,为了保正一致性,必须有锁的介人。数据库系统使用锁是为了支持对共享资源进行并发
听风北念
·
2022-09-03 17:08
mysql
学习笔记
mysql
数据库
java
MySQL之Innodb_buffer_pool_size设置方式
目录Innodb_buffer_pool_size设置方式
缓冲池
相关参数说明合理的设置缓存池相关参数设置innodb_buffer_pool_size参数Innodb_buffer_pool_size设置方式
缓冲池
是用于存储
·
2022-08-24 15:34
MySQL灵魂十连问
目录1、SQL语句执行流程2、BinLog、RedoLog、UndoLog3、MySQL中的索引4、SQL事务隔离级别5、MySQL中的锁6、MVCC7、
缓冲池
(bufferpool)8、table瘦身
zhangkaixuan456
·
2022-08-16 23:47
sql优化
mysql
数据库
服务器
跟我学Springboot开发后端管理系统4:数据库连接池Druid和HikariCP
WEB系统高并发环境下,频繁的进行数据库连接操作,造成系统技术瓶颈问题(无效的资源开销),通过为数据库连接为建立一个“
缓冲池
”。
公众号:方志朋
·
2022-08-15 08:31
数据库
mysql
java
jdbc
spring
缓冲池
buffer pool的解释
那就是也加个缓存也就是这里的bufferpool了,缓存页数据与索引数据,把磁盘上的数据加载到
缓冲池
,避免每次访问都进行磁盘IO,起到加速访问的作用。一.bufferpool是什么?
名字是乱打的_闭关写项目中
·
2022-08-03 16:47
C++实现页面的缓冲区管理器
具体要实现以下的函数:~BufMgr():清除所有脏页并释放
缓冲池
和BufDesc表voidadvanceClock():用来找到下一个时钟的位置voidallocBuf(FrameId&frame):
·
2022-08-01 18:19
数据库——连接池(特点及步骤)
①导入jar包,②测试连接代码,③写配置文件QueryRunner插入操作QueryRunner查询操作引言:世事万物有盛衰,人生安得常少年连接池概念数据库连接池的基本思想:就是为数据库连接建立一个“
缓冲池
学JAVA的秀琴
·
2022-07-26 16:39
数据库
database
MySQL系列---架构与SQL执行流程详解
连接3.1.1MySQL支持的通信协议3.1.2通信方式3.2缓存3.3解析器3.4查询优化器和查询执行计划3.4.1优化器3.4.2执行计划3.5执行引擎3.6存储引擎4.更新SQL语句执行流程4.1
缓冲池
lipviolet
·
2022-07-24 16:10
MySQL系列
mysql
数据库
java线程池的四种创建方式详细分析
目录前言1.线程池2.创建方式前言在讲述线程池的前提先补充一下连接池的定义连接池是创建和管理一个连接的
缓冲池
的技术,这些连接准备好被任何需要它们的线程使用可以看到其连接池的作用如下:1.线程池线程池(英语
·
2022-07-14 11:22
【SQL性能优化】精华篇:关于索引以及
缓冲池
的一些解惑
下面的内容主要包括了索引原则、自适应Hash、
缓冲池
机制和存储引擎等。关于索引(B+树索引和Hash索引,以及索引原则)什么是自适应Hash索引?
刘秋宇
·
2022-07-06 10:05
SQL必知必会
SQL
性能优化
索引
缓冲池
存储引擎
CMU15445 (Fall 2019) 之 Project#1 - Buffer Pool 详解
前言这个实验有两个任务:时钟替换算法和
缓冲池
管理器,分别对应ClockReplacer和BufferPoolManager类,BufferPoolManager会用ClockReplacer挑选被换出的页
之一Yo
·
2022-06-30 23:00
MySQL InnoDB内存结构之Buffer Pool
InnnoDB的数据都是放在磁盘上的,而磁盘的速度和CPU的速度之间有难以逾越的鸿沟,为了提升效率,就引入了
缓冲池
技术,在InnoDB中称之为BufferPool。
时空恋旅人
·
2022-06-13 07:00
MySql全卷
mysql
java
数据库
InnoDB学习笔记二
缓冲池
(buffer pool)
文章目录一、bufferpool1.
缓冲池
(bufferpool)2.BufferPool高并发场景3.调整BufferPool修改配置调整chunk机制调整4.BufferPool内存如何设置BufferPool
liushangzaibeijing
·
2022-05-20 12:58
mysql
innodb缓冲池
LRU
LIST
Free
List
Flush
list
Python内建类型bytes深入理解
目录引言1bytes和str之间的关系2bytes对象的结构:PyBytesObject3bytes对象的行为3.1PyBytes_Type3.2bytes_as_sequence4字符
缓冲池
引言“深入认识
·
2022-05-17 15:20
一文读懂MySQL调优
MySQL数据库配置优化个人使用过的参数总结:表示
缓冲池
字节大小。推荐值为物理内存的50%~80%。innodb_buffer_p
在奋斗的大道
·
2022-04-15 14:28
Java架构专栏
java
MySQL
缓冲池
(buffer pool),终于懂了!!!(收藏)
操作系统,会有
缓冲池
(bufferpool)机制,避免每次访问磁盘,以加速数据的访问。MySQL作为一个存储系统,同样具有
缓冲池
(bufferpool)机制,以避免每次查询数据都进行磁盘IO。
58沈剑
·
2022-04-13 15:30
数据库
算法
java
mysql
缓存
第五篇:MySQL之
缓冲池
(buffer pool)和写缓冲(change buffer)
1、bufferpoolbufferpool的优点bufferpool是MySQL在内存中开辟的一片区域,用来存放磁盘中的数据页。利用redolog和bufferpool可以提高读取效率。当要读取的数据页在bufferpool中,直接在内存中读取得到,不用再读取磁盘。如果要修改数据页,将相关日志顺序写道redologfile中。bufferpool的管理算法MySQL中的bufferpool采用的
张孟浩_jay
·
2022-04-13 15:57
MySQL
mysql
数据库
MySQL写缓冲(change buffer),终于懂了!!!(收藏)
上篇《MySQL
缓冲池
(bufferpool),终于懂了》,介绍了InnoDB
缓冲池
的工作原理。
58沈剑
·
2022-04-13 15:43
数据库
算法
mysql
java
缓存
SQL索引与不走索引的优化
前言在传统的系统应用程序中我们通常都会和[数据库]建立连接进行数据的读写操作,为了减少连接数据库造成的资源消耗于是有了数据库连接
缓冲池
。
老鼠AI大米_Java全栈
·
2022-04-11 14:13
MySQL 的 Buffer Pool,终于被我搞懂了
为此,Innodb存储引擎设计了一个
缓冲池
(BufferPool),来提高数据库的读写性
小林coding
·
2022-04-07 14:14
图解MySQL
mysql
innodb
Innodb存储引擎中的后台线程详解
目录1.mastethread2.IOThread3.purgethread4.pagecleanerthread总结1.mastethread负责将
缓冲池
中的数据异步刷新到磁盘,保证数据的一致性。
·
2022-04-02 12:55
一文了解MySQL的Buffer Pool
摘要:Innodb存储引擎设计了一个
缓冲池
(BufferPool),来提高数据库的读写性能。本文分享自华为云社区《MySQL的BufferPool,终于被我搞懂了》,作者:小林coding。
华为云开发者社区
·
2022-03-28 11:00
RocketMQ设计之异步刷盘
在返回写成功状态时,消息可能只是被写入了内存的PAGECACHE,写操作的返回快,吞吐量大;当内存里的消息量积累到一定程度时,统一触发写磁盘操作,快速写入RocketMQ默认采用异步刷盘,异步刷盘两种策略:开启
缓冲池
·
2022-03-21 11:21
GBASE 8s Light Append简介
Lightappend是一种可绕过
缓冲池
开销的大数据量的以块的方式快速追加到表中的方式。
八珍豆腐
·
2022-02-28 15:43
gbase
8s
数据库
国产数据库
database
【Linux】生产者消费者模型
它的描述是:有一群生产者进程在生产产品,并将这些产品提供给消费者进程去消费,为使生产者与消费者能并发的执行,在两者之间设置了具有n个缓冲区的
缓冲池
,生产者进程将其所生产的产品放入一个缓冲区中;消费者进程可从一个缓冲区中取走产品
小魏同学i
·
2022-02-27 20:16
Linux
生产者-消费者
线程
Java基础题
基本类型
缓冲池
值booleantrue/falsebyte所有值short-128~127int-128~127char\u0000to\u007F3、String是不是可变长度?不是,因为它被声明为
A雄
·
2022-02-26 14:45
为面试而生
java
开发语言
后端
你知道 MySQL update 语句背后藏着哪些不可告人的秘密?
缓冲池
·
2022-02-25 11:49
javamysql
遇到tableView卡顿嘛?会造成卡顿的原因大致有哪些?
如果重用cell,为cell创建一个ID,每当需要显示cell的时候,都会先去
缓冲池
中寻找可循环利用的cell,如果没有再重新创
geekAppke
·
2022-02-21 17:56
《MySQL性能优化和高可用架构实践》阅读总结
文章目录介绍第1章MySQL架构介绍1.1MySQL简介1.2MySQL主流的分支版本1.3MySQL存储引擎1.4MySQL逻辑架构1.5MySQL物理文件体系结构第2章InnoDB存储引擎体系结构2.1
缓冲池
悬浮海
·
2022-02-18 15:30
mysql
mysql
数据库
mysql性能优化
高可用
Java设计模式之 [10] 结构型模式 - 享元模式
像数据库连接池.里面都是创建好的连接对象,在这些链接对象中由我们需要的就直接拿来用,避免重新创建,如果没有我们需要的,就重新创建一个3.享元模式能够解决重复对象内存浪费的问题,当系统中有大量相似对象,需要
缓冲池
的时候
是小猪童鞋啦
·
2022-02-11 22:52
MySQL的日志体系
1.RedoLog熟悉MySQLInnoDB引擎的人都知道,InnoDB有一个最重要的概念就是
缓冲池
,这是在内存中分配的一个区域,InnoDB会将数据首先缓存在此,请求首先去命中
缓冲池
,无法命中
缓冲池
的才会在磁盘上进行检索
有财君
·
2022-02-06 17:29
超详细图解!【MySQL进阶篇】SQL优化-索引-存储引擎
ManagementServices&Utilities:管理服务和工具组件SQLInterface:SQL接口组件Parser:查询分析器组件Optimizer:优化器组件Caches&Buffers:
缓冲池
组件
Java架构没有996
·
2022-02-04 17:25
IT服务
java架构
分享心得
mysql
数据库
sql
java
后端
进程间通信的方式
它们之所以低级的原因在于:效率低,例如在生产者消费者问题中,生产者和消费者只能互斥的向
缓冲池
刚入门的代码spa技师
·
2022-02-04 17:19
操作系统
Linux
操作系统
多进程
上一页
4
5
6
7
8
9
10
11
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他